diff --git a/home-manager/vscode.nix b/home-manager/vscode.nix index 595f608..4e5e7a7 100644 --- a/home-manager/vscode.nix +++ b/home-manager/vscode.nix @@ -4,6 +4,13 @@ package = pkgs.vscode; enableUpdateCheck = false; mutableExtensionsDir = false; + keybindings = [ + { + key = "ctrl+[BracketRight]"; + command = "workbench.action.terminal.focus"; + when = "terminalProcessSupported"; + } + ]; userSettings = { # Note: In settings.json, `.` in a key is not equivalent to a nested object property. # Language-specific @@ -34,7 +41,7 @@ "debug.allowBreakpointsEverywhere" = false; # "editor.fontFamily" = "'Monaspace Neon Var', Arial"; "editor.fontLigatures" = true; - "terminal.integrated.scrollback" = 20000; + "terminal.integrated.scrollback" = 10000; }; extensions = with pkgs.vscode-extensions; [ bmalehorn.vscode-fish